Metallica has confirmed its next live performance, scheduled for October 1 at the Sphere in Las Vegas, Nevada.

The show is part of the band’s ongoing tour, with the full itinerary available at https://www.metallica.com/tour/.

In addition, Metallica: Album By Album (Motorbooks), authored by music historian Martin Popoff, will be published on September 15, 2026.

The hardcover book, featuring over 200 photographs and Popoff’s detailed commentary, examines each of the band’s 11 studio albums, from Kill ‘Em All to 72 Seasons.

What sets the book apart is its all-star contributor lineup, including Soundgarden guitarist Kim Thayil, Metal Blade founder Brian Slagel, Judas Priest’s Richie Faulkner, Anthrax bassist Frank Bello, Grammy-winning producer Will Putney, Queensrÿche vocalist Todd La Torre, Cannibal Corpse drummer Paul Mazurkiewicz, and YouTube personalities Anthony Fantano, Mike Kupris, and John Gaffney.

Their insights form a roundtable discussion that captures the band’s evolution, songwriting breakthroughs, and behind-the-scenes milestones.

The book places each album within the broader context of heavy metal history, offering readers a fresh perspective on Metallica’s legacy.
